Uninstall a Web Tier on Windows
During uninstallation, run the RSA Authentication Web-Tier Uninstaller for Windows on the web-tier server. Uninstalling a web tier removes the web tier and all features and components of RSA Authentication Manager from the web-tier server.
Uninstalling a web tier does not delete the web-tier deployment record.
Before you begin
Confirm that you have Windows credentials to uninstall a program.
Procedure
On the web-tier server, go to Start > Control Panel > Programs and Features > Uninstall a Program.
Right-click RSA Authentication Web Tier, and select Uninstall.
On the command line, type:
y
and press ENTER.
When finished, the uninstaller screen displays Uninstall finished.
Press ENTER.
The system removes the web tier services and installation folders, except the top-level folder.
After you finish
On the primary instance, use the Operations Console to delete the web-tier deployment record. For instructions, see Delete a Web-Tier Deployment Record.
(Optional) On the DNS server, delete the hostname and IP address for the web tier that you uninstalled.
